将家里的电脑用作服务器是一种常见的做法,特别是在资源有限、需求不高或仅用于测试和开发目的的情况下,以下是关于如何将家用电脑转变为服务器的一些步骤和注意事项:
1. 确保硬件配置满足需求
在决定使用家用电脑作为服务器之前,需要确认其硬件配置是否满足服务器运行的最低要求,这包括CPU的性能、内存的大小、硬盘的空间以及网络连接的稳定性。
组件 | 建议配置 |
CPU | 多核心处理器,至少双核 |
内存 | 4GB以上,推荐8GB或更高 |
硬盘 | 固态硬盘(SSD)以提高读写速度 |
网络 | 稳定的有线网络连接 |
2. 选择合适的操作系统
选择一个适合服务器用途的操作系统是关键,Linux发行版如Ubuntu Server、CentOS或Debian是常见的选择,因为它们稳定、安全且免费,Windows Server也是一个选项,尤其是当需要运行特定的Windows应用程序时。
3. 安装必要的软件
根据服务器的用途,你需要安装相应的服务器软件,如果是Web服务器,可能需要安装Apache、Nginx或IIS;如果是数据库服务器,则可能需要MySQL、PostgreSQL或Microsoft SQL Server。
4. 配置防火墙和安全设置
保护服务器免受未经授权的访问是非常重要的,确保配置了防火墙规则,只允许必要的端口和服务对外开放,定期更新操作系统和应用程序以修补安全漏洞。
5. 考虑备份和冗余
为了防止数据丢失,应该定期备份服务器上的重要数据,如果可能的话,设置RAID或其他形式的磁盘冗余可以提高数据的可用性和可靠性。
6. 监控和维护
定期监控服务器的性能和健康状况,以便及时发现并解决问题,这可能包括检查日志文件、监控系统资源使用情况以及执行安全审计。
相关问题与解答
Q1: 使用家用电脑作为服务器有哪些潜在风险?
A1: 使用家用电脑作为服务器存在一些潜在风险,包括但不限于数据安全问题、硬件故障的风险、网络攻击的可能性以及性能瓶颈,为了降低这些风险,需要采取适当的安全措施,如使用强密码、定期更新软件、监控网络流量等。
Q2: 如果我想将家用电脑转变为生产环境的服务器,应该注意什么?
A2: 如果你想将家用电脑用于生产环境,需要考虑更多的因素,包括硬件的可靠性、网络的稳定性、电源供应的连续性以及数据的安全性,你可能还需要考虑合规性问题,确保你的服务器符合任何相关的法律和行业标准,在这种情况下,可能更适合投资专业的服务器硬件和托管服务。
小伙伴们,上文介绍了“家里的电脑做服务器”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。